Not so surprising....
....that it's the "usual suspects".
There is a subset of anglers who utilize the internet boards to gather/share information. They keep on the lookout for new sources. This source is in competition with the older, established source.
If you look at what happened on the Hull Truth, you can see that the same thing took place. There was a lot of complaining about the board when it was sold to Internet Brands, but when Wiley started Reel Boating once his non-competition agreement ran out, RB has not gained much traction.
Unfortunately, I don't see this board or RB offering much "value added" content, so I don't even check in on either that much. The established board, in spite of perceptions of shortcomings (most of which I don't share) offers more content.
I am not in sales, but I see market saturation in a market with limited customers, and unless a new source can offer better content or really differentiate itself in some other way, it is just not going to prosper.
